ZIP 71226 and ZIP 71227 are ZIP Code areas in Louisiana.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 71227 has the higher population (4,099 vs 1,806 in ZIP 71226). ZIP 71227 has the higher median household income ($60,810 vs $45,000 in ZIP 71226). ZIP 71227 has the higher median home value ($209,900 vs $76,200 in ZIP 71226).
